#613009 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#613009 is composed of 38% red, 18.8% green and 3.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 50.5% magenta, 90.7% yellow and 62% black. It has a hue angle of 26.6 degrees, a saturation of 83% and a lightness of 20.8%. #613009 color hex could be obtained by blending #c26012 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

● #613009 color description : Very dark orange [Brown tone].
#613009 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#613009 has RGB values of R:97, G:48, B:9 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.51, Y:0.91,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 6369289.

Shades and Tints of #613009
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070401 is the darkest color, while #fef9f4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#613009
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#383532 is the less saturated color, while #692f01 is the most saturated one.
